Exchange Students Talk With NLCS Board About Bedford/U.S.A.

(BEDFORD) - The North Lawrence Community Schools Board of Trustees was treated to reports from seven of the eight exchange students attending Bedford North Lawrence High School.
The students come from all over the globe. Two are from Brazil, 2 from Sweden, one from Germany, whom joked about living in Williams with his host family, one from Armenia, and another from Australia.
Robert Lee, III, from Bedford, spoke about being an exchange student in Brazil. He spoke about going to a private school and living with his host family. He said the home had 10 servants.
The others expressed how sports here was more emotional than in their countries. Team spirit was much higher here than at their home countries. Most have about another year of schooling before heading back to their native homes.
